They were preparing for a several-thousand-dollar repair.

A dental office we hadn't worked with before noticed they were losing oxygen and contacted their usual equipment service provider. Over the phone, they were told they likely needed a several-thousand-dollar replacement part.

Before moving forward, they called North Star.

We were able to get a technician to the office quickly to take a look. By the time we arrived, their oxygen tanks had emptied, so once the tanks were refilled, we returned to test the system and find out what was actually happening.

The expensive part wasn't the problem.

We found that the flowmeter had been left on and the system needed new check valves. We replaced the valves, tested the system, and got everything functioning as it should again—for considerably less than the repair they had been expecting.

Sometimes good service isn't about replacing the most expensive part. It's about showing up, finding the actual problem, and getting it fixed.

The office didn't even know there was a problem.

During annual maintenance, we found that one of the three heads on this dental air compressor had stopped running. The other two were keeping up, so the office hadn't experienced any interruption at all.

We originally installed this compressor in 2012. After 14 years of service, the system is now obsolete and parts are no longer available, so this time replacement made more sense than repair.

We helped the practice choose a properly sized Tech West Elite oil-less compressor, giving them the capacity they need today and a system built for the years ahead.

This is why we believe in looking after equipment for the long haul. The right equipment. Regular maintenance. Problems caught early. And good guidance when it's finally time for something new.

Fourteen years later, we're grateful to still be helping this practice with what comes next.

Equipment still working doesn't always mean repairing it is the best investment.

And an expensive repair doesn't automatically mean it's time to replace it.

Age, parts availability, reliability, repair history, workflow and the cost of downtime can all change the answer.

That's why we don't believe every service call should end with the same recommendation.

Sometimes, repair it. Sometimes, replace it. Sometimes, keep it running and start planning for what's next. Our job is to help you understand the options so you can make the decision that's right for your practice.

An office recently called about an older dental light with paint that was flaking from years of cleaning and disinfectant use.

The light itself was still working well. The concern was appearance, cleanliness, and loose paint in the treatment area. Fortunately, we still had replacement parts available.

A relatively simple repair gave the light a much cleaner appearance and helped extend the life of equipment that was otherwise serving the office well.

Not every situation calls for replacement. Sometimes the best solution is helping good equipment continue doing its job.
